Just how do I know when my pipes have burst?


Fluctuating water pressures


Pipes do not just burst in a day. You may have discovered that your cooking area faucet or shower does not run promptly when you transform the faucet. It may pause for a few secs and afterwards blast you with even more force than typical.
In other circumstances, the water might appear typical at first, after that drop in pressure after a few secs.

Infected water


Lots of people presume a burst pipeline is a one-way electrical outlet. Quite the contrary. As water spurts of the hole or tear in your plumbing system, pollutants find their method.
Your water might be polluted from the source, so if you can, examine if your water storage tank has any type of problems. Nonetheless, if your alcohol consumption water is supplied as well as cleansed by the city government, you must call your plumber right away if you see or scent anything amusing in your water.

Puddles under pipes and sinks


When a pipeline bursts, the discharge develops a puddle. It might show up that the pool is growing in size, and also regardless of how many times you wipe the puddle, in a couple of mins, there's another one waiting to be cleansed. Typically, you might not have the ability to map the puddle to any kind of visible pipelines. This is an indication to call a professional plumber.

Damp walls and also water stains


Prior to a pipe bursts, it will certainly leak, most times. If this consistent leaking goes undetected, the leak might graduate right into a broad wound in your pipe. One very easy method to avoid this emergency is to watch out for wet wall surfaces advertisement water stains. These water spots will lead you right to the leakage.

Untraceable dripping noises


Pipeline bursts can take place in the most undesirable areas, like within concrete, inside walls, or under sinks. When your home goes silent, you may have the ability to hear an aggravatingly persistent trickling noise. Even after you have actually checked your shower head as well as cooking area faucet, the dripping might proceed.
Precious viewers, the dripping may be originating from a pipe inside your walls. There isn't much you can do concerning that, except inform a specialist plumber.

What do I do when I spot a burst pipe?


Your water meter will certainly remain to run even while your water wastes. To lessen your losses, discover the major controls and also turn the supply off. The water mains are an above-ground structure at the edge of your home.

How Do You Know if a Pipe Has Burst


  • Flooding. The most obvious sign – if you notice puddles of water on the floor, if the walls are very wet, and if you see the water meter spinning like crazy, then you have a flood.


  • Bubbling walls. When the water leakage is not that obvious, you can notice bubbles forming under the paint or wallpapers of your walls.


  • Mould. Another sign for too much moisture. Some homes have this problem regardless, but if you’re experiencing mould for the first time in a while, the reason might be a broken pipe.


  • Patches of extra green grass. If a pipe has burst outside your home and around your yard, water would be flooding on your lawn. And if there are patches of very green grass, it’s probably a damaged pipe.


  • How to Fix a Broken Pipe Inside a Wall


  • Cut out sections of the damaged drywall with a saw. Once you are completely sure where the damage is located, cut the wall in order to have access.


  • Wrap a sheet around the pipe and move around until it gets wet. If you don’t have the luck to see the breakage with your own eyes, you’ll need to find it with a sheet of cloth. You may have to repeat this a few times until you pinpoint the exact place of the breakage.


  • Place a container under the broken pipe. The plumbing repair will be messy, so the container should catch anything that spills from the pipe you’re about to work on.


  • Cut the pipe below the leak. You need to use a pipe cutter tool for this. Screw the tool tightly and rotate until the pipe is cut through.


  • Dry the pipe. You can’t work if it’s wet.


  • Cut above the leak with a pipe cutter again.


  • Clean the pipe. This includes both the inside and outside. The inside might hold more ice, so make sure it’s clear from any obstructions.


  • Mount a copper repair sleeve. Use a blowtorch to heat the bottom end of the repair sleeve. Allow the solder to melt and fill the joint. After it cools in about 10 minutes, do the same for the upper end. Wear safety goggles and gloves when doing this. Check for leaks after you’re done.


  • Patch the wall.
